How to Generate your IMEI and MEP Numbers Manually


This page will help you generate your IMEI and MEP numbers manually, if you are having trouble with the IMEI/MEP reader.


1) On your BlackBerry keyboard press ALT + CAPS + H keys
(you will need to press all three buttons at the same time, not individually)

Note: For Pearl and other Sure-type phones press and hold the ALT key (Bottom left) and type E A C E, for Storm, hold the BACK arrow, and tap the screen in the following areas:TOP LEFT, TOP RIGHT, TOP LEFT, TOP RIGHT.

2) You should be presented with a screen with several different numbers. Look for Device PIN, App version, and Uptime, and enter them EXACTLY as they appear into the fields below, then click the "Get my code” button. Stay on this screen on your BlackBerry, do not exit this screen otherwise you will have to start from Step 1. Make sure you don’t have any extra spaces in any of the fields below. A code will appear next to "Your key is:”.

3) Type this code into your BlackBerry. Again you must still be on the screen that shows the App version, PIN, and Uptime, and you must type this code while on that screen. If you exited back to the main screen on the BlackBerry, the key code above will not work. YOU WILL NOT SEE ANY THING ON THE SCREEN AS YOU TYPE THE CODE, JUST TYPE IT IN ANYWAY. Make sure you press the alt button before entering numbers! For example, if the code given to you below is 98FF5EA9, then you would press: alt 9 alt 8 f f alt 5 e a alt 9.

4) Now you should be in the Engineering Screen Contents menu. Scroll down and select OS Engineering Screens.

5) In the next screen, scroll down and select Device Info.

6) In the next screen, scroll down and look for your MEP number. It will be in this format: MEP-XXXXX-XXX where each X is a number. You may have to scroll quite a bit as the MEP code is near the bottom of this screen. This is your BlackBerry’s MEP code! Write it down somewhere.

7) Now for your IMEI number, exit the Engineering Screens by pressing the Back button on your BlackBerry. Once you get to your BlackBerry’s main screen, type the following using your BlackBerry’s keyboard: *#06#

8) Your IMEI number should now appear on the screen. You now have both your IMEI and MEP codes!  



Did the above steps not work? Here are some common mistakes we make when trying to get the MEP number manually. 


1) If you have a bracket in your App version, make sure you leave a space before the opening bracket. For example, if App version is 5.0.0.1 (422), leave a space between the "1" and the "(", so in the field above, you would enter it as 5.0.0.1 (422) instead of 5.0.0.1(422).

2)When entering the uptime, do not enter the word "seconds" into the box. So if your Uptime is 867 seconds, just enter the number 867.

3) When you get the code from above, make sure you are still on the screen that displays the Uptime, App Version and Pin information. In other words, after pressing alt + caps + H in step 1, you are taken to the screen displaying those 3 pieces of information. You MUST stay on that screen until it's time to enter the code. If you exit the screen and go back, the Uptime will have changed and so you will have to generate a new code.

4) Lastly, ensure you press and release the alt button before each number in the code. So if the code is AFH7J76C, you would type a f h alt 7 j alt 7 alt 6 c. Follow those pointers and you should have no problem generating your MEP number.
